L. M. Wilson is a scholar working on Polymers and Plastics, Organic Chemistry and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ials. According to data from OpenAlex, L. M. Wilson has authored 22 papers receiving a total of 539 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Polymers and Plastics, 8 papers in Organic Chemistry and 6 papers in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ials. Recurrent topics in L. M. Wilson’s work include Liquid Crystal Research Advancements (5 papers), Synthesis and properties of polymers (5 papers) and Organometallic Complex Synthesis and Catalysis (4 papers). L. M. Wilson is often cited by papers focused on Liquid Crystal Research Advancements (5 papers), Synthesis and properties of polymers (5 papers) and Organometallic Complex Synthesis and Catalysis (4 papers). L. M. Wilson coll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, United States and Germany. L. M. Wilson's co-authors include Manfred Bochmann, Anselm C. Griffin, Michael B. Hursthouse, Majid Motevalli, Richard L. Short, Ian Hawkins, Richard D. Cannon, Alan H. Windle, Roderick D. Cannon and Upali A. Jayasooriya and has published in prestigious journals such as Macromolecules, Journal of Materials Chemistry and Inorganic Chemistry.
